PRIME NO
#include<stdio.h>
int main()
{
int n,c;
printf("enter the no\n");
scanf("%d",&n);
if(n==2)
{
printf("prime\n");
}
else
{
for(c=2;c<=n-1;c++)
{
if(n%c==0)
{
break;
}
}
if(c!=n)
{
printf("not prime\n");
}
else
{
printf("prime\n");
}
}
}

PRIME NO IN FACTOR
PRIME NO IN FACTOR
#include<stdio.h>
void main()
{
int number,num;
printf("Enter a number ");
scanf("%d",&number);
printf("\nThe prime factors of %d are:",number);
for(num=2;num<=number;num++)
{
int i=2;
while(i<=num-1)
{
if(num%i==0)
{
break;
}
i++;
}
if(i==num)
{
if(number%num==0)
{
number=number/num;
printf("\t%d",num);
num=1;
}
else
{
continue;
}
}
}
}

FACTORIAL PROGRAM WITHOUT FUNCTION
#include<stdio.h>
void main()
{
int fact=1,i,x;
printf("enter the no in factorial");
scanf("%d",&x);
for(i=1;i<=x;i++)
{
fact=fact*i;
}
printf("%d ",fact);
}
